One such situation can be considered wherein you are unable to start your Windows XP system. In this case, either of the following message is displayed

• Missing operating system.
• Operating system not found.

Reasons:

Such problems occur when there is some undesirable issues with the active partition in your system. Some are them are:

• The Sector 0 of the hard drive is having corrupt MBR.
• The partition that is marked as Active is incompatible.
• The partition containing the MBR is not active.
• The hard disk is corrupt.

Solutions:

For the aforementioned causes, the following methods are suggested:

• Check the BIOS settings: You should check the BIOS settings and check whether the booting preferences are properly defined to boot the correct storage media. If not, then adjust the settings accordingly. Restart the system after saving the settings.
• Use fixmbr tool: If the previous method does not work, then you should enter the Recovery Console using the Windows XP Setup CD. Then, use the the FIXMBR command to repair and rebuild the MBR of the active partition.

If the system is still not able to start properly, then you should re-install the Windows XP operating system. However, in that case all the data would not be secure or may get removed.
